Following Emerging Trends in Real Estate, this breakfast program takes a deeper dive into the data driving housing and development decisions across Central Indiana. Using current market and demographic data, the conversation will ground the year’s series in the realities of housing supply, demand, affordability, and market conditions.
While the focus is housing, the implications extend far beyond residential development. Housing trends influence workforce availability, retail viability, neighborhood stability, and overall community health—making this discussion essential for developers, investors, planners, and public-sector leaders across all real estate sectors.

The North Split was just the start. The rest of the I-65/I-70 Inner Loop is nearing the end of its life and will need to be substantially rebuilt. The interstate has created a massive barrier around Downtown Indianapolis. We can transform acres of under-utilized space and unleash limitless opportunities to revolutionize our city. Join us at the ULI Indiana May Breakfast to learn more information about this once-in-a-lifetime opportunity and what’s possible for development with a recessed interstate!
